**Ticket: Expired credentials — Chattermill log sampler**

Plugin authors: the sampling credentials for the Chattermill log pipeline expired last Tuesday, which is why your plugins have been receiving empty sample batches instead of the usual 1% slice of the Dornfeld service logs. The sampler itself is healthy; only authentication failed. We've minted a replacement credential with identical scopes. Update your plugin config to use the new key below.

app token of yagaf-bahop = vxb2-4d

## Deployment

The Tidebroom sweeper runs as a cron pod in the Harlock cluster — nothing fancy. It scans for orphaned volumes and stale load balancers, then tags or deletes based on age. Dry-run is the default, so don't panic on first deploy.

It reads its settings from the environment at startup, namely these.

service settings:
[silwyn]
host = silwyn.crelvogrid.internal
user = silwyn_svc
database = silwyn_prod

Ticket #4471 — PixelVault image cache eating memory again. Heads up, support folks: the leak in the thumbnail cache on the Brindlewood cluster got worse after our service creds expired last Tuesday. The cache stopped evicting because auth failures against the purge endpoint were silently swallowed, so entries just piled up. Fix is merged, but you'll need the renewed key to restart the purge worker manually. Use the key below when calling the purge endpoint.

gateway credential: vxb15-ybzv6EpZJxoKxSj